About

Bethel a'r Felinheli ward encompasses the village of Y Felinheli, situated along the Menai Strait, and the rural area of Bethel inland. The ward's landscape includes a stretch of the strait's shoreline, with views towards Anglesey, and extends into the agricultural hinterland of Gwynedd. The area is connected by the A487 road, which runs through it, linking to Bangor and Caernarfon.

A specific feature is the presence of the historic Pont Felinheli, a masonry bridge crossing the Afon Gwyrfai. The ward contains residential housing, local services, and maritime activity centred on the strait, alongside farmland. The community is served by Ysgol Gynradd Felinheli and falls within the wider cultural and administrative context of the county.

On average Bethel a'r Felinheli has very low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 44 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 5.2%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Bethel a'r Felinheli is £50,700 per year. Bethel a'r Felinheli is home to around 3,645 people, with a population density of about 236.1 per km2.

Property prices in Bethel a'r Felinheli

Based on 52 recent sales, the median property price is £222,500 in Bethel a'r Felinheli area, with individual transactions ranging from £82,000 up to £495,000.
